Cherubimon sends down a bolt of lightning to murder Kouji and Kouichi steps in with his brand-spanking new Spirit.
Spoiler:
Kouji's a twelve-year-old Japanese male, who, upon my findings in previous calcs, tend to be 1.524m tall. If you want me to go look for it, I can, but regardless it's pretty reasonable.
Anyway, one's head tends to be 1/8th of his/her height, so .1905m for Kouji's head.
Never mind, Mike says manga characters' heads are 1/5.7-1/6.5 of their bodies. I'll use an average of 1/6.1. So, Kouji's head is .25m.
Angsizing the distance to Kouji...
2*atan(63.2/(674/tan(70/2)))=7.513005171928
...we get 1.9m.
Those other lines will come in later.
Spoiler:
Here, Kouichi intercepts the bolt some distance from Kouji's head. To get the distance traveled, we'll subtract these.
(.25/158.5)645=1.017
1.9-1.017=0.883m
This is from Wombat's roamer calc. To get a timeframe, I'll divide the distance by this velocity of 61111.1m/s.
0.883/61111.1111=0.0000144490909117 :lmao
Spoiler:
Back to this scan. I figured I'd just use the edges of the panel for min and max distances traveled by L?wemon.
Low-End
(.25/63.2)129=0.51m
.51/0.0000144490909117=35296.33m/s or about mach 104.
High-End
(.25/63.2)303=1.2m
1.2/0.0000144490909117=83050.2m/s or about mach 244.
Now back to the other scan.
Spoiler:
I can also find the distance his arm moves, assuming he lifts it from his waist.
Using pixel scaling...
(.25/158.5)401=0.6325m
s=r(theta)
s=0.6325(1.8)
s=1.1385m
1.1385/0.0000144490909117=78793.88m/s or about mach 232.
However, a half-meter arm for a guy easily taller than the average human is :psyduck
So I'm just going to use 2m for L?wemon's height and see how that goes.
One's arm is generally half the length of his/her height, so...
s=1(1.8)
s=1.8
1.8/0.0000144490909117=124575.3m/s or about mach 366.
